Jane class

When asked how many students were in class, Jane said, "If we increase the number of students in our class by 100% and then add half the number of students, we get 100." How many students are in Jane's class?

Correct answer:

x =  40

Step-by-step explanation:


x+x+x/2=100

5x = 200


x = 200/5 = 40

x = 40
